Structural foundation repair services address issues related to the stability and integrity of a property’s foundation. These services typically cover projects such as leveling uneven slabs, repairing or replacing cracked or damaged concrete, addressing settlement or shifting of the foundation, and stabilizing bowing or leaning walls. Property owners often seek this type of repair when noticing signs like cracks in walls or floors, doors or windows that won’t close properly, or visible shifts in the structure’s alignment. Understanding the scope of work involved and the potential causes of foundation problems can help homeowners make informed decisions before requesting repairs.
Before initiating foundation repair, property owners should consider factors such as the extent of damage, the age of the property, and the underlying causes of foundation movement. It’s important to evaluate whether the issues are isolated or part of a larger pattern of settlement, as this can influence the appropriate repair approach. Additionally, understanding the types of repair methods available-such as underpinning, piering, or stabilization-can help homeowners determine what solutions may be suitable for their specific situation. Proper assessment and planning are key to ensuring the long-term stability of a property’s foundation.

Common Structural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ation Stabilization - techniques to prevent shifting and settling of existing structures.
Crack Repair - sealing and filling foundation cracks to maintain structural integrity.
Pier and Beam Repair - reinforcing or replacing support piers to improve stability.
Concrete Lifting - raising sunken concrete slabs to restore level surfaces.
Drainage Solutions - improving water flow around the foundation to prevent water damage.
Basement Wall Reinforcement - reinforcing or waterproofing basement walls to prevent bowing and leaks.
Structural Foundation Repair Questions
What are signs of foundation issues? Common signs include c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ly.
What causes foundation settlement? Settlement can result from soil shrinkage, poor drainage, or changes in moisture levels around the property.
What types of foundation repair are available? Repairs may involve underpinning, piering, or stabilization to restore stability and prevent further movement.
How can foundation problems affect a property? Unaddressed issues can lead to structural damage, increased repair costs, and decreased property value.
